Descubra estratégias essenciais de backup automatizado do n8n em VPS Linux, protegendo seus fluxos de automação e garantindo a segurança dos seus dados em 2025.

Com a crescente adoção do n8n para automação de fluxos e agentes de IA, garantir que esses processos estejam protegidos contra falhas ou perdas de dados tornou-se uma prioridade para quem utiliza servidores VPS Linux. O backup automatizado do n8n em VPS Linux é mais do que uma medida técnica: é uma prática fundamental para a continuidade dos negócios e a segurança das informações, especialmente em 2025, com ambientes de TI cada vez mais dinâmicos e ameaças digitais sofisticadas.
Neste artigo, vamos abordar por que o backup automatizado é indispensável, quais dados devem ser incluídos, as melhores práticas para garantir segurança, como criar scripts automatizados e, por fim, como restaurar e validar seus backups. Se você está começando a usar o n8n em VPS Linux ou busca aprimorar a proteção dos seus fluxos, este guia é para você! Prepare-se para automatizar a segurança do seu n8n com dicas práticas e atualizadas.
Por que realizar backup automatizado do n8n em VPS Linux?
A realização de backups automatizados do n8n em VPS Linux não é apenas uma recomendação — é uma necessidade para quem depende da automação para tarefas críticas ou para atender clientes. Em ambientes Linux, onde o controle da infraestrutura é maior, a automação dos backups oferece tranquilidade e agilidade em caso de incidentes.
Entre as principais razões para adotar o backup automatizado do n8n em VPS Linux, destacam-se:
- Prevenção de perda de dados: Falhas de hardware, ataques cibernéticos ou erros humanos podem comprometer fluxos valiosos. Com backups regulares, você recupera rapidamente seu ambiente.
- Agilidade na recuperação: Um backup atualizado permite restaurar o serviço em minutos, minimizando downtime e impacto nos negócios.
- Atualizações e testes seguros: Antes de aplicar atualizações no n8n ou testar novos fluxos, ter um backup evita dores de cabeça caso algo dê errado.
- Conformidade com políticas de segurança: Muitas empresas precisam cumprir normas de proteção de dados, e o backup automatizado ajuda a atender esses requisitos.
Além disso, a automação dos backups evita a dependência de tarefas manuais, reduzindo esquecimentos e erros. A segurança dos seus fluxos do n8n deve ser tratada com a mesma seriedade com que se protege qualquer dado essencial do negócio.
🤖 Aprenda a dominar backups, automação e muito mais com a Formação Agentes de IA
Se você está buscando não só proteger seus fluxos n8n com backup automatizado, mas também explorar todo o potencial dessa plataforma aliado à Inteligência Artificial, vale muito a pena conhecer a Formação Agentes de IA do Hora de Codar. Ela é perfeita para quem quer criar agentes inteligentes, automatizar processos de forma profissional e até entrar no mercado de automações mesmo sem ser programador.
Um dos módulos cobre exatamente a infraestrutura, automações avançadas e práticas para garantir ambientes seguros e escaláveis no n8n usando VPS Linux. Além disso, ao participar, você terá acesso a uma comunidade ativa, templates prontos, atualizações frequentes e orientações práticas para criar projetos reais.
Se automatizar seu backup já parece incrível, imagina aprender também a criar agentes de IA que trabalham por você? Recomendo dar uma olhada: Confira todos os detalhes da Formação Agentes de IA e veja como evoluir rápido no universo da automação!
Quais dados do n8n devem ser incluídos no backup?
O n8n armazena suas configurações, fluxos (workflows), credenciais e informações de execução em arquivos e bancos de dados específicos. Ao estruturar um backup automatizado do n8n em VPS Linux, é crucial saber exatamente quais dados precisam ser salvos para garantir uma restauração efetiva em caso de necessidade. Veja os principais itens:
- Banco de dados do n8n: Normalmente em SQLite, Postgres ou MySQL. É onde ficam os fluxos, credenciais e dados operacionais.
- Diretório de dados do n8n: Contém arquivos internos, como settings, logs e possivelmente arquivos temporários de execução.
- Arquivos de configuração (Environment Variables/.env): Guarda ajustes personalizados de conexão, integrações e chaves.
- Arquivos de workflow customizados: Se você mantém scripts ou módulos próprios, inclua-os no backup.
- Docker volumes ou Compose files (caso use Docker): Inclua volumes persistentes associados ao container do n8n e arquivos de orquestração.
É interessante mapear todo o ambiente do seu n8n, listar os diretórios relevantes e verificar o local de armazenamento do banco de dados — em instalações padrão, geralmente fica em ~/.n8n ou definido por variáveis de ambiente. Assim, o backup cobre tudo o que é essencial para restaurar o ambiente rapidamente.
Veja na prática como instalar e gerenciar o n8n em VPS Linux
Para facilitar ainda mais seu entendimento sobre operações em VPS Linux e deixar seu ambiente pronto para rotinas de backup, recomendamos assistir ao vídeo “COMO INSTALAR n8n NA VPS EM 5 MINUTOS!” no canal Hora de Codar. O tutorial mostra o processo desde a criação até a configuração de um n8n funcional em VPS, passo a passo, e é perfeito para quem está começando ou quer garantir as melhores práticas de instalação. Assista agora:
👉 Aproveite para se inscrever no canal e conferir outros tutoriais essenciais sobre automação, agentes de IA e n8n.
Melhores práticas de backup seguro para n8n em ambientes Linux
Implementar as melhores práticas de backup seguro é fundamental para garantir que, no momento em que mais precisar desses dados, eles estejam íntegros e prontos para uso. Algumas recomendações importantes para quem quer elevar o nível de proteção dos backups do n8n em VPS Linux:
-
Automatize totalmente seus backups
Programe scripts ou utilize ferramentas como cron para realizar backups regulares (diários ou até horários, conforme necessidade). Automatizar reduz o risco de falhas humanas. -
Mantenha múltiplas versões e histórico
Não confie apenas na última cópia. Guarde histórico de versões anuais, mensais e semanais, permitindo recuperação de estados anteriores. -
Armazene backups em múltiplos locais
Utilize pelo menos dois destinos: armazenamento local e nuvem (como S3, Dropbox, Google Drive). Assim, você protege seus backups mesmo em caso de falha do servidor. -
Proteja com criptografia e restrição de acesso
Sempre criptografe os arquivos de backup e limite seu acesso apenas a pessoas e processos autorizados. -
Documente seus processos de backup e recuperação
Tenha um passo-a-passo para backup e restauração acessível a todos que possam precisar acionar esses procedimentos. Em momentos de crise, um guia bem elaborado faz toda diferença.
Estas práticas tornam o backup do n8n em VPS Linux muito mais confiável e resistente a diversos cenários de perda de dados.
Como criar e agendar scripts de backup automatizado do n8n na VPS
A criação e o agendamento de scripts para backup automatizado do n8n em VPS Linux são etapas-chave para garantir que a segurança dos dados aconteça sem depender de ações manuais. Veja um passo a passo prático para iniciantes:
- Escreva um script simples para backup
Exemplo de script bash para salvar o banco de dados, arquivos de configuração e a pasta de dados do n8n:
!/bin/bash
DATA=$(date +”%Y-%m-%d%H-%M-%S”)
BACKUPDIR=”/caminho/do/backup/n8n-$DATA”
mkdir -p $BACKUPDIR
cp -r ~/.n8n $BACKUPDIR/
cp /caminho/do/banco/n8n.sqlite $BACKUP_DIR/
Inclua outros diretórios/arquivos relevantes
- Torne o script executável
No terminal, rode:
chmod +x backup_n8n.sh
- Agende o script via cron
Edite o cron com crontab -e e insira uma linha para rodar (por exemplo, diariamente às 3h):
0 3 * * * /caminho/para/backup_n8n.sh
Com isso, seu backup automatizado estará funcionando sem sua intervenção direta, reduzindo riscos e garantindo que mesmo iniciantes consigam manter a segurança. Aprimorar esse script com compressão, upload para nuvem e verificação de integridade pode ser um passo seguinte conforme sua experiência for avançando.
💻 Hospede seu n8n com segurança e facilidade na VPS da Hostinger
Se você quer rodar n8n em VPS Linux e garantir backups seguros com mais tranquilidade, vale considerar a Hostinger. Lá você encontra planos de VPS já otimizados para n8n, com recursos escaláveis, uptime de 99,9% e um painel intuitivo para instalar, gerenciar e crescer seu ambiente.
O serviço oferece instalação facilitada do n8n, nodes da comunidade liberados, upgrades sob demanda e suporte técnico especializado. Além do backup automatizado, isso dá estabilidade e possibilidades para expandir suas automações sem dor de cabeça.
Quem acompanha o Hora de Codar tem ainda desconto especial! Conheça os planos e utilize o cupom HORADECODAR para garantir o melhor preço: Acesse a VPS Hostinger para n8n
Como restaurar e validar backups do n8n no VPS Linux
Restaurar um backup do n8n em VPS Linux é um passo essencial para garantir que, caso ocorra algum problema, você consiga trazer seu ambiente ao funcionamento rapidamente. O processo é mais fácil do que parece e o segredo está na prática e documentação. Vamos aos passos fundamentais:
- Pare o serviço do n8n: Antes de restaurar, interrompa o serviço (com systemctl stop n8n ou parando o container Docker) para evitar conflitos.
- Recupere os arquivos de backup: Copie os diretórios do backup para o local original, como o diretório ~/.n8n e o arquivo do banco.
- Restaure permissões: Certifique-se de que os arquivos restaurados estão com o mesmo usuário/grupo do serviço n8n.
- Reinicie o serviço: Ligue novamente o serviço do n8n para validar se tudo está funcionando normalmente.
- Teste os principais fluxos: Execute workflows críticos e confira as credenciais para garantir que nada foi corrompido no processo.
Dica extra: sempre que possível, tenha um ambiente de teste/sandbox para treinar o processo de restauração. Validar que o backup funciona é tão importante quanto fazê-lo. E mantenha seus backups organizados por data, facilitando encontrar a versão ideal para restaurar.
Como configurar um backup automatizado do n8n em uma VPS Linux?
Para configurar um backup automatizado do n8n em uma VPS Linux, utilize scripts de automação (em bash ou similar) que copiem arquivos essenciais, como a pasta de dados do n8n e o banco de dados utilizado. Agende a execução desses scripts com o cron, garantindo cópias regulares em servidores externos ou serviços de nuvem para maior segurança.
Quais arquivos ou pastas do n8n são essenciais para o backup automatizado?
Os principais itens para backup do n8n incluem a pasta ‘n8n/.n8n’, onde ficam fluxos, credenciais e configurações, além do banco de dados (SQLite, PostgreSQL, MySQL ou outro, dependendo da sua configuração). Certifique-se de incluir estes dados no backup automatizado para garantir a restauração completa dos fluxos.
Com que frequência devo realizar o backup automatizado do n8n na VPS Linux?
A frequência do backup depende do uso do seu n8n, mas recomenda-se que seja feito, no mínimo, diariamente. Para ambientes com alta frequência de alterações em fluxos e credenciais, o ideal é configurar backups horários para maior segurança e evitar perda de dados.
Conclusão: Backup automatizado do n8n em VPS Linux é garantia de tranquilidade
Manter um backup automatizado do n8n em VPS Linux é uma decisão estratégica para qualquer projeto de automação. Com os riscos cada vez maiores de perdas de dados, ataques cibernéticos ou mesmo simples erros de atualização, investir nessas práticas te coloca em outro nível de segurança e profissionalismo.
Relembrando os pontos principais: sempre saiba o que deve ser incluído no backup, automatize o máximo possível, armazene as cópias de forma segura (em locais variados) e não esqueça de validar periodicamente o processo de restauração. Tudo isso garante que seu ambiente n8n funcione sem surpresas – mesmo no pior cenário.
Aproveite também para se aprofundar em infraestrutura, scripts de backup e agentes de IA com treinamentos como a Formação Agentes de IA, e escolher VPS confiáveis como a Hostinger para crescer com tranquilidade.
Com essas dicas, você estará mais preparado para 2025 e para qualquer desafio na automação de fluxos com n8n em ambientes Linux.

